Hard to predict with certainty. But last Thursday (strike day) I flew to BCN. Two LHR flights were cancelled. My LGW flight had to fly round France and it took 3 hours plus to each there (via Lands End, Out over Atlantic and down etc.)

Yes there certainly can be impacts.
My most recent MAD flight was cancelled and the flight I did take probably took 30-40 minutes extra flying time. It's not predictable and so it might well be worthwhile giving yourself enough leeway to cope with a cancellation and extra flying time. If this means an overnight to be sure, then I would recommend doing this. The situation in France shows no signs of an early resolution. |
Yesp - same happened to me in June 2014. Big delay in flight departing LGW for BCN, then had to fly out over the Scilly Isles before heading south and then back east south of the Pyrenees over Portugal and Spain.

I would expect 1-1.5 hour increase in flight time with cancellations to match (so maybe 1/3 cancelled) assuming BA use the oceanic route outside the influence of French ATC.
Creative back to back or self-constructed connections should be avoided. |

Looks like this is too late for the OP as he has already rebooked, but for others who may be affected:
http://www.britishairways.com/travel...s/public/en_gb Any customer due to fly to or from any French airport as well as Madrid and Barcelona on Thursday June 2, Friday June 3, Saturday June 4 and Sunday June 5, regardless of whether their flight is operating or not can bring their flight forward up to Wednesday June 1 or move it back to a date up to and including Friday 10 June. All rebookings are subject to availability |
